Wir arbeiten oft mit der Eingabeaufforderung oder CMD in Windows-Umgebungen, um mehrere mit dem Computer oder Benutzern verbundene Aufgaben auszuführen, wie z. B. Informationen abrufen, neue Profile erstellen, Parameter bearbeiten, Programme öffnen und vieles mehr.
Die Eingabeaufforderung in Windows-Betriebssystemen enthält eine Funktion, mit der wir den Verlauf der Befehle speichern können, die wir über verschiedene Tastenkombinationen wie die unten gezeigten verwendet haben.
1. Tastenkombinationen für die Eingabeaufforderung
Pfeiltaste nach obenEs ermöglicht uns, den zuletzt ausgeführten Befehl zu visualisieren, wir können ihn weiter drücken, um die vorherigen ausgeführten Befehle anzuzeigen
Hoch
AbwärtstasteDenken Sie an den folgenden schriftlichen Befehl. Wir können darauf drücken, um den Befehlsverlauf anzuzeigen
Runter
Avpag-TasteEs ermöglicht uns, den ersten Befehl zu erhalten, der in der aktuellen Sitzung verwendet wird
Avpag
Pfeiltaste nach obenEs ermöglicht uns, den neuesten Befehl der aktuellen Sitzung abzurufen
RePag
Esc-TasteLöschen Sie die gesamte Befehlszeile
Esc
Auf die gleiche Weise ermöglichen uns einige Funktionstasten, bestimmte Aktionen an der Eingabeaufforderung auszuführen, wie zum Beispiel:
F7-TasteDiese Option ermöglicht es uns, den Befehlsverlauf in einem Popup-Fenster anzuzeigen, in dem wir den gewünschten Befehl durch Drücken der Pfeiltasten auswählen können.
F7
F8-TasteEs ermöglicht uns, den gesamten Befehlsverlauf nach einem Befehl zu durchsuchen, der die aktuelle Bedingung erfüllt. Beispielsweise können wir den Buchstaben C in die Befehlszeile eingeben und F8 drücken, um alle Befehle anzuzeigen, die mit diesem Buchstaben beginnen. Wir können dann diese Taste drücken, um alle Optionen anzuzeigen
F8
F9-TasteEs ermöglicht uns, einen in der Historie gespeicherten Befehl abzurufen, der seine Nummer im Historienpuffer anzeigt. Wir werden diese Nummern in einem Popup-Fenster sehen und das nächste Mal, um agiler darauf zuzugreifen, verwenden Sie einfach die F9-Taste und die entsprechende Nummer
F9
Wenn wir die Liste aller in der Eingabeaufforderung verwendeten Befehle sehen möchten, verwenden wir den folgenden Befehl:
dokey / geschichteDas Ergebnis wird folgendes sein:
Das gleiche Ergebnis erhalten wir mit der Taste F7.
2. So kopieren Sie vorherige Befehle in die Eingabeaufforderung
Der vorherige Befehl, den wir an der Eingabeaufforderung ausführen, ist als Vorlage bekannt, und wir haben mehrere Möglichkeiten, diese Dateien zu kopieren.
F1-TasteDiese Option kopiert ein Zeichen einzeln aus dem zuvor geschriebenen Befehl, also Buchstabe für Buchstabe.
F1
F2-TasteMit dieser Option können wir einen Teil des Befehls kopieren früher die wir geschrieben haben, fordert uns das System auf, bis das Zeichen einzugeben, das wir kopieren möchten
F2
F3-TasteDiese Option ermöglicht es uns, einen zuvor ausgeführten Befehl abzuschließen, dh, wenn wir jetzt ping -3 soletic.com eingegeben haben, können wir jetzt ping -5 schreiben und F3 drücken, um den vorherigen Befehl abzuschließen.
F3
3. So löschen Sie den Befehlsverlauf an der Eingabeaufforderung
Die praktischste Methode zum Löschen des Befehlsverlaufs an der Eingabeaufforderung ist das Schließen des Fensters, da wir uns auf Linux-Systemen daran erinnern, dass der Verlauf auch nach dem Schließen des Terminals noch aktiv ist. Wir können den folgenden Befehl ausführen, damit sich die Eingabeaufforderung in Windows an keinen Befehl erinnert:
doskey / listsize = 0Mit dieser Option können wir die Funktionen der Taste F7 oder des Befehls doskey / history nicht ausführen, sondern nur während der aktuellen Sitzung aktiv sein. Der Befehl cls (Clear Screen) ist nützlich, um den Befehlsverlauf zu löschen, ohne das aktive Fenster schließen zu müssen, solange wir den Befehl ausgeführt haben doskey / listsize = 0 vorher.
4. So speichern Sie den Befehlsverlauf an der Eingabeaufforderung
Möglicherweise möchten wir irgendwann den Verlauf der an der Eingabeaufforderung ausgeführten Dateien für eine Verwaltungs- oder Kontrollaufgabe sichern.
Dazu verwenden wir den doskey-Befehl und einen definierten Pfad, um diese Befehle zu speichern. Die zu verwendende Syntax ist die folgende.
doskey / history> C:\users\User\Desktop\commands.txt
Das Zeichen > leitet das Ergebnis an den angegebenen Pfad weiter. Nun gehen wir zum angegebenen Pfad und öffnen die von uns erstellte Datei:
VERGRÖSSERN
Auf diese Weise können wir auf einfache und nützliche Weise Aktionen für die Eingabeaufforderungsbefehle in Windows-Umgebungen ausführen.